Higher Level Teaching Assistant (Level 4)

Higher Level Teaching Assistant (HLTA)Start date: Autumn Term 2026Hours: Monday–Friday, 8.30am–4.30pm35 hours per week, Term Time + 5 INSET (Teacher) DaysRushey Mead Primary School is seeking a highly motivated, creative and enthusiastic Higher Level Teaching Assistant to join our established HLTA team. This role will involve a significant amount of planned class cover, alongside collaborative work supporting teaching and learning across the school.This is an excellent opportunity for a dedicated and experienced practitioner who is an effective communicator, demonstrates initiative and flexibility, and enjoys working as part of a supportive and professional team.

The successful candidate will:

  • Hold a Level 4 TA qualification (or equivalent)
  • Be confident delivering planned cover across year groups
  • Work effectively as part of a team of HLTAs, teachers and support staff
  • Demonstrate high expectations for pupils’ achievement and behaviour
  • Show creativity, adaptability and a positive sense of humour
  • Have a secure understanding of the Early Years Framework and/or National Curriculum
  • Be committed to continuous professional development and inclusive practice

We are looking for someone who can demonstrate:

  • Enthusiasm and a strong commitment to pupil progress
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Flexibility and resilience in a busy school environment
  • A positive, collaborative approach to teamwork

We can offer:

  • Well-behaved, motivated and enthusiastic children
  • A supportive, friendly and experienced staff team
  • Strong professional development opportunities
  • Positive relationships with parents and governors
  • A welcoming school community where staff wellbeing is valued

Salary:Local Government Band 7, Points 19–22£35,412 – £38,220 FTEPro rata: £28,909 – £31,202Visits to the school are warmly welcomed and encouraged.

Closing date: Monday 31st August 2026 at 9:00amInterviews: W.B 7th September 2026
